Cardinal Flower – A Beginners Guide – GrowIt BuildIT
Cardinal Flower is a short lived perennial flower native to North America. Scientifically known as Lobelia cardinalis, it will grow to a height of 3-4′ in full sun with moist organic soil. A member of the Campanulaceae family, it will bloom red flowers for six weeks in late Summer and is excellent at attracting hummingbirds.
